Module: Kernel
- Defined in:
- lib/awesome_print_motion/core_ext/kernel.rb
Overview
Copyright © 2010-2012 Michael Dvorkin
Awesome Print is freely distributable under the terms of MIT license. See LICENSE file or www.opensource.org/licenses/mit-license.php
Class Method Summary collapse
Instance Method Summary collapse
- #ai(options = {}) ⇒ Object (also: #awesome_inspect)
Class Method Details
.ap(object, options = {}) ⇒ Object
14 15 16 17 |
# File 'lib/awesome_print_motion/core_ext/kernel.rb', line 14 def ap(object, = {}) puts object.ai() object unless AwesomePrint.console? end |
Instance Method Details
#ai(options = {}) ⇒ Object Also known as: awesome_inspect
8 9 10 11 |
# File 'lib/awesome_print_motion/core_ext/kernel.rb', line 8 def ai( = {}) ap = AwesomePrint::Inspector.new() ap.awesome self end |